The probabilistic power flow methodology deals with the uncertainties in power systems. Compared to the traditional deterministic power flow, this approach provides the overall spectrum of all probable values of the desired output variables. In this paper, the methods based on the properties of cumulants of random variables are considered. An in-depth analysis of such cumulant-based probabilistic power flow calculations is presented. A comparison of their features is given in detail through both a theoretical analysis and some case studies. Results on IEEE 14-bus and IEEE 300-bus Test Systems are presented and compared taking as benchmark the results obtained by the Monte Carlo methodology. Moreover, suitable suggestions to the exploit their features in the different power system applications are given. Further researches on these methods are also being developed to increase the accuracy and the computational efficiency.
